Output 83a4454fa8fe6ea32d1058cf7db5d1a2e2ed240bb0bc81b2d6e0e078ff097f69:1

value
89499014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09e3cd7bc7ea3475d237d54353d14b0fe38db0e3 OP_EQUAL
address
32bJuH2q7EqNgANvpHJabiC2uM16Lt5bLJ
transaction
83a4454fa8fe6ea32d1058cf7db5d1a2e2ed240bb0bc81b2d6e0e078ff097f69
spent
true